Quick answer
The average sale price in SA18 is £107,676 (median £90,000), based on 214 HM Land Registry transactions. Police UK recorded 16 crimes within a 1-mile radius in 2026-05.
Headline pricing in SA18 is below the UK national average (England & Wales average ~£290k as of 2025). Stock is dominated by detached properties (74 of the last 214 sales).
